The Venezuela microtome market grapples with several restraints rooted in the nation's ongoing economic and political challenges. Economic instability has severely hampered access to advanced medical technology, creating barriers to the import of quality microtomes. In addition, inflation and fluctuating exchange rates contribute to unpredictable pricing and financial forecasts, complicating both operational strategies and budgeting for healthcare institutions. Such conditions create a complex landscape that manufacturers and suppliers must navigate, making sustainable operations increasingly difficult.
Current trends in the Venezuela microtome market highlight a pronounced shift towards automated and semi-automated devices, which enhance precision and workflow efficiency. Laboratories are increasingly investing in microtomes that boast user-friendly features, such as touch-screen interfaces and integration with digital imaging systems, facilitating improved sample analysis and documentation. Furthermore, a growing emphasis on compact designs and minimal maintenance requirements reflects the sector's adaptation to both space and operational constraints in local facilities.

Government policies in Venezuela have profound implications for the microtome market, primarily through stringent price controls and import regulations. These interventions impact the availability of high-quality medical equipment, causing shortages that hinder growth. Additionally, initiatives aimed at healthcare expansion and investment in research infrastructure are critical for enhancing market conditions. Continued dialogue between governmental bodies and industry stakeholders will be essential in addressing challenges and promoting sector stability.
